CPTM Workers Launch Indefinite Strike Halting Three Commuter Lines

The stoppage threatens commutes to São Paulo’s East Zone, Alto Tietê and Guarulhos airport as authorities prepare emergency buses.

Overview

  • An assembly called by the STEFZCB approved an indefinite strike that began at midnight and suspended service on CPTM lines 11‑Coral, 12‑Safira and 13‑Jade.
  • The union alleges roughly 500 workers were dismissed during the lines’ handover to private operators and is demanding job guarantees and a review of the concession contracts.
  • CPTM has temporarily reassumed administration of the three ramais for up to 90 days after operational failures by the concessionaire while investigations proceed.
  • State agencies plan contingency steps including activating the PAESE emergency bus plan and asking the labor court to fix minimum staffing levels to keep some service running.
  • Millions of commuters face longer trips, station closures and crowded replacement buses as negotiations and likely judicial mediation continue.
